Lee Bonna Fay “Bonnie” Summers, 81, formerly of Sullivan, passed away on Monday, March 30, 2015 at her daughter’s home in Conroe, TX. She was born March 24, 1934 in Ishmael, MO, the daughter of the late Clarence and Opal (Blount) McMillen. She married Charles Monroe Summers on September 1, 1948, he preceded her in death in April 1987.
Bonnie is survived by three children, one son, Charles Jerry Summers and wife, Jessica; two daughters, Sandra Kay Fortin and husband, Jorge, and Terrie Jean Gaskill and husband, Robert; seven grandchildren, Gary M. Summers, Jr., Stephanie Kay Ogden, Stacy Ann Ogden, Rebecca Booth, Summer Dawn Beeman, Mark Summers, and Jarrod Gaskill; sixteen great-grandchildren; one brother Billie McMillen; one sister Nancy Juergens and husband, Dale; one daughter-in-law, Judy Summers and one sister- in-law, Wilma McMillen.
Bonnie was preceded in death by one son Gary Monroe Summers and one daughter Patricia Carol Tilley.
Bonnie moved to Sullivan after Charles passed away. In the last few years, she began to winter in Texas. She loved to cook, look at recipe books, crochet, talk with friends on the phone and watch TV. In her earlier years, she was a sales clerk at Fairway Drug.
Private funeral services were held at the Eaton Funeral Home in Sullivan. Burial followed at the I.O.O.F Cemetery.
